World War II was primarily triggered by the invasion of Poland by Nazi Germany on September 1, 1939. This aggressive act violated the Treaty of Versailles and prompted Britain and France to declare war on Germany on September 3, 1939, marking the official beginning of the conflict. Additionally, aggressive expansionist policies by Germany, Italy, and Japan throughout the 1930s created a volatile geopolitical landscape that ultimately led to the war.
